Output 873c759a9b99c605c5630b899a67f10133654f2e3a7b392511f7544015238066:900

value
2682459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9e1bc0bc388820552e91a6db17984b8ef948c9a OP_EQUAL
address
3MZ4yUxH7XcnuTrFTeT5BkaxdsY7M9YcuJ
transaction
873c759a9b99c605c5630b899a67f10133654f2e3a7b392511f7544015238066
spent
true